Overview:

This position is contingent upon award of the contract. Supervises daily construction work performed at the site. Construction Superintendents report directly to the assigned On-Site Project Manager .

Primary Responsibilities:
  • Directly supervise and coordinate activities of numerous minor construction projects.
  • Perform supervisory and management functions reporting to On-Site Project Manager.
  • May also engage in the same construction trades work as the workers being supervised.
  • Supervise crews to obtain top quality workmanship, efficiency, employee satisfaction, morale, communication, commitment, teamwork, and pride.
  • Reviews and verifies crew time sheets and submits to Payroll on specified days.
  • Recognizes and communicates any priority projects or problems, such as employee or job costing issues and complaints from the client.
  • Ensures that proper safety and incident reporting procedures are followed, bring problems to the attention of the On-Site Project Manager, Construction Manager, Safety Department, or HR Manager.
  • Coordinate subcontract work onsite for all trades assigned to the project.

Supervisory Responsibilities:

  • Coordinates, directs, and leads workers engaged in construction activities.

Olgoonik Corporation is an Alaska Native-owned village corporation established under the terms of the Alaska Native Claims Settlement Act. Headquartered in Wainwright along the coast of the Chukchi Sea, the Corporation is owned by more than 1,300 Alaska Native shareholders, almost half of whom live in the community. Since our incorporation in 1973, Olgoonik has steadily assembled a proven record of past performance through its reputable companies.
